Transportation & Parking Guide
🚇 The Yuntai Garden subway station is under construction and will provide seamless access once it opens! For now, we recommend taking the bus or a taxi. If you're driving, you can park at the Baiyun Shuangyan Robot Parking Lot or the Yunshan Tiandi Parking Lot for easy access to your flower-viewing adventure.
Complete Guide to the Most Beautiful Routes
Start from Yihua Square (Visitor Center) and unlock hidden gems like the Mixiang Garden, Lanting, and Shengyan Square. Finally, return to the visitor center along Kapok Road. This route connects the highlights of the botanical garden, so you won't miss a thing!
Six Must-Visit Photo Spots
1️⃣ Petal Square: A palette of flowers! Bougainvillea in various colors bloom freely, with delicate pinks and passionate reds. Every photo is a winner and will flood your social media!
2️⃣ Yihua Square: The green lake reflects the rockery, red flowers, and green trees, like a traditional ink painting. The bougainvillea by the lake is the perfect finishing touch. Snap a photo for an atmospheric masterpiece.
3️⃣ Lanting: A paradise for orchid lovers! You can not only admire a wide variety of orchids but also encounter ferns with unique fragrances. We highly recommend the 2-meter-long Queen Staghorn Fern, which is spectacular and eye-catching!
4️⃣ Shengyan Square: The layers of flower seas are super healing! The white stairs wind through them, making you feel like you've stepped into a fairy tale. Whether you take a panoramic shot or a close-up, it will be breathtaking.
5️⃣ Kapok Road: The park's central landmark! The 2 km-long Kapok-themed boardwalk features giant kapok flower sculptures and winding paths. Stroll along and enjoy the lush greenery. Every photo is a forest-style masterpiece.
6️⃣ Kapok Platform: The highest point in the park! Here, you can not only overlook the beauty of the entire botanical garden but also see the Canton Tower in the distance, capturing the blend of city and nature.
Super Practical Tips
✅ Head straight to the second floor of the visitor center after entering the park. It has restaurants and viewing platforms. Recharge before starting your journey!
✅ Lanting and Kapok Boardwalk are must-sees! You can see the Canton Tower from the high point of the Kapok Boardwalk, and the bald cypress trees on the Jihu Platform are also a beautiful autumn sight (limited to autumn and winter).
✅ The Kapok Boardwalk is flat and easy to walk, making it suitable for the elderly and children. There is also a dessert and tea shop on the second floor of Kapok Platform, perfect for a break when you're tired.
✅ If you want to quickly visit Kapok Road, go to the second floor after entering the park and turn left to go directly to the entrance. If you want to explore slowly, turn right to discover more surprising attractions.
